9 pm: Sue Foley and Peter Karp, presented by Tantramarsh Blues Society,George¹s Roadhouse, 67 Lorne St. Sue Foley and Peter Karp (Ottawa and NYC), This critically acclaimed acoustic duo performs music based on a CD that was #1 on the Blues charts for 6 weeks. The music itself originates from a correspondence between the two artists that records their respective trials and tribulations, which eventually became songs. The thing is that both are musicians with strong independent careers of their own. Sue Foley is perhaps the preeminent female guitar-singer in Canada who began her career with bang by recording with Antone¹s many moons ago. Peter Karp is a singer-songwriter who has recorded with the fine Blind Pig blues label out of California. For more on the duo, please visit: www.suefoley.com. 2 pm: Atanarjuat The Fast Runner Film Screening, Mount Allison Wu Centre. Zacharias Kunuk, renowned Inuk director will be introducing and screening his internationally celebrated film "Atanarjuat The Fast Runner" at Mount Allison University. Kunuk is one of Canada’s most celebrated filmmakers, with Atanarjuat The Fast Runner being the first Inuktitut language feature film ever made and having won numerous awards, including the Caméra D’or at the Cannes Film Festival in 2002, six Genie awards, including for Best Picture and Best Director, and being voted one of the most important Canadian films ever made by the Toronto International Film Festival.
